Understanding Blockchain Projects
Blockchain projects often start with a whitepaper that outlines their vision, objectives, and technical details. This document is crucial for anyone considering involvement. It lays out the project's goals, the technology behind it, and the team driving it forward. Pay attention to the project's whitepaper because it often contains vital information on token distribution, governance models, and use cases.
Early-Stage Investments
One of the most lucrative ways to earn from blockchain projects is through early-stage investments. This could be through Initial Coin Offerings (ICOs), Initial DEX Offerings (IDOs), or token presales. Early investors can benefit from significant upside as the project matures. However, it’s essential to conduct thorough due diligence. Look at the team's background, the project’s roadmap, and the market demand for its solution.
Joining Development Teams
Another strategy is to join the development team of a blockchain project. This involves contributing to the codebase, helping to design smart contracts, or creating the user interface. While this route requires technical expertise, it often results in earning through token incentives. Many blockchain projects reward developers with tokens for their contributions, which can appreciate in value over time.
Affiliate Marketing and Promotions
Many blockchain projects rely on affiliate marketing to grow their user base. If you have a following or a large online presence, you can earn by promoting these projects. Some projects offer affiliate programs where you can earn a percentage of the revenue generated through new users you bring in. It's a win-win situation where you earn while helping the project grow.
Participating in Community Governance
Blockchain projects often have decentralized governance systems where token holders can vote on important decisions. Participating in these governance processes can also be a way to earn. Some projects offer governance tokens that provide voting power and sometimes yield rewards. Being active in the community can lead to earning through governance rewards and influencing project direction.
Leveraging Decentralized Finance (DeFi)
DeFi platforms are built on blockchain and offer various financial services without intermediaries. Participating in DeFi can be a lucrative way to earn from blockchain projects. You can earn interest by lending your tokens, provide liquidity to decentralized exchanges (DEXs), or even earn through yield farming. Always ensure the DeFi platform is secure and has a solid track record.

Strategic Tokenomics Understanding
Tokenomics is the study of the monetary system of a blockchain project, including token distribution, incentives, and economic models. Understanding tokenomics is vital for long-term earning potential. Analyze the token supply, distribution methods, and incentives for early adopters. Projects with well-thought-out tokenomics often see more stable growth and higher returns on investment.
Yield Farming and Liquidity Provision
Yield farming and liquidity provision are advanced DeFi strategies where you can earn by providing liquidity to decentralized exchanges. By staking your tokens or providing liquidity, you earn fees and sometimes additional tokens as rewards. Platforms like Uniswap, SushiSwap, and PancakeSwap offer various liquidity pools where you can participate. It’s essential to understand the risks involved and to diversify your liquidity across multiple pools.
Staking and Delegation
Staking involves locking up your tokens to support the network’s operations, and in return, you earn rewards. Different blockchain networks offer varying staking rewards. For instance, Ethereum 2.0 rewards validators for their contribution to the network’s security. Delegation is a similar concept but typically used in Proof-of-Stake (PoS) blockchains where you delegate your tokens to a validator who then stakes them on your behalf. Both methods offer passive income streams.
Smart Contract Audits
If you have expertise in blockchain development, conducting smart contract audits can be a lucrative opportunity. Smart contracts are self-executing contracts with the terms directly written into code. However, they can contain vulnerabilities that malicious actors might exploit. Reputable blockchain projects often seek third-party audits to ensure the security and integrity of their smart contracts. Offering auditing services can lead to substantial earnings.
Creating and Selling NFTs
Non-Fungible Tokens (NFTs) have gained massive popularity, and creating and selling them can be profitable. Blockchain projects often launch their own NFT platforms or collections. If you have artistic or creative skills, you can create unique digital assets and sell them on platforms like OpenSea or Rarible. Some projects also offer incentives for creating and promoting their NFTs.
Participating in Bug Bounty Programs
Many blockchain projects run bug bounty programs to identify and fix vulnerabilities in their smart contracts and systems. By participating in these programs, you can earn rewards for discovering and reporting bugs. This not only helps secure the blockchain network but also provides a financial incentive for your efforts. Platforms like HackerOne and Gitcoin often list such opportunities.
Engaging in Advanced Trading Strategies
Trading blockchain project tokens can be highly profitable if done strategically. Advanced trading strategies involve using technical analysis, market trends, and algorithmic trading to maximize profits. Platforms like Binance, Kraken, and others offer advanced trading tools and features. Engaging in high-frequency trading or using trading bots can also help you capitalize on market movements.

Ethical Considerations and Regulatory Frameworks
As we embrace the benefits of AI, robots, and PayFi, ethical considerations and the need for robust regulatory frameworks become increasingly important. The ethical use of AI, particularly in decision-making processes, is a critical concern. Algorithms that power AI systems can inadvertently perpetuate biases present in the data they are trained on, leading to unfair outcomes.
To address this, ethical guidelines and standards need to be established, ensuring that AI systems are transparent, accountable, and fair. This includes developing bias detection and correction mechanisms, and involving diverse stakeholders in the development process.
In the realm of financial systems, the transition to PayFi and the rise of decentralized finance (DeFi) bring both opportunities and risks. While DeFi offers greater financial inclusion and transparency, it also poses challenges in terms of regulation and security. Developing regulatory frameworks that balance innovation with consumer protection will be crucial in ensuring the stability and integrity of financial systems.
